Lets compare vitamin content per 500 calories of Canned Carrots with Liquids and Salt vs Soy Cheese:
500 calories of Canned Carrots with Liquids and Salt have 2012.2 times more Vitamin A, more Vitamin B1, 1.3 times more Vitamin B2, 5.5 times more Vitamin B3, 7.9 times more Vitamin B5, 10.5 times more Vitamin B6, 2.4 times more Vitamin B9, more Vitamin C, 8 times more Vitamin E and 14 times more Vitamin K than Soy Cheese.
500 calories of Soy Cheese have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B1, Vitamin B5 and Vitamin C
Both Canned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t as well as Soybean, curd cheese have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 500 calories.
Comparing minerals per 500 calories for Canned Carrots with Liquids and Salt vs Soy Cheese:
500 calories of Canned Carrots with Liquids and Salt have 1.8 times more Copper, 3.3 times more Manganese, 5.7 times more Potassium, 78.8 times more Sodium and 8.6 times more Water than Soy Cheese.
While 500 kcal of Soybean, curd cheese contain 1.6 times more Iron, 3.9 times more Magnesium, 1.7 times more Phosphorus and 6.4 times more Selenium than Canned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t.
Both Canned Carrots with Liquids and Salt and Soy Cheese contain similar levels of Calcium and Zinc per 500 calories.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 500 calories:
500 calories of Canned Carrots with Liquids and Salt have 5.1 times more Carbohydrate, 10.1 times more Sugars and more Fiber than Soy Cheese.
While 500 kcal of Soybean, curd cheese contain 8.8 times more Fat, 7.1 times more Saturated Fat, 10.3 times more Omega 3, 11 times more Omega 6 and 3.3 times more Protein than Canned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t.
Both Canned Carrots with Liquids and Salt and Soy Cheese offer comparable quantities of Energy per 500 calories.
500 calories of Canned Carrots with Liquids and Salt provide inadequate amounts of Omega 6
500 calories of Soy Cheese provide inadequate amounts of Fiber
